An 8x8 LED dot matrix display is a compact visual component consisting of 64 individual LEDs arranged in an 8x8 grid. Each LED can be individually controlled, allowing for the creation of various characters, symbols, and even simple animations. These displays are popular for their versatility and ease of use with microcontrollers like Arduino. The displays themselves can vary in terms of color (typically red, green, or blue), brightness, and power consumption.

Connecting an 8x8 LED dot matrix display to an Arduino is generally straightforward. This usually involves connecting the display's power, ground, and data pins to the corresponding pins on your Arduino board. The specific wiring will depend on the chosen display and its interface (SPI or I2C). Libraries like the U8g2 library simplify the process of controlling the display with Arduino code. You'll need to install the library and then use its functions to write text, numbers, and custom graphics to your display.
